FREE & UNIFORM EDUCATION FOR ALL
The education is backbone of a society .Unfortunately the education system
prevailing in India is good for only for rich and urban middle class population
as they can afford pay high fees of public Schools . However average middleclass and poor are worst sufferer of the existing education system due to high
cost .The poor and rural population is dependent upon government schools
which lack poor infrastructure and poor quality .

Performance in Government schools
The condition of government schools in small towns and in villages is very poor.
There are many problems of prevailing school system in villages and small
towns. One of the key problem is lack of accountable management system at
state level. Besides grant and financing through several rural education
schemes the system suffers from various problems such as:
1. The availability of dedicated and serious teachers.
2. The teachers do not get proper wages in time and hence lose interest.
3. Lack of school infrastructure - No proper shelter to protect from sun and
rain, no proper sitting arrangement, no toilets, no tools to teach, no
computers and lack of sports equipments and so on.
4. The lack of roads, transport and connectivity of schools to nearby villages.
It is seen that students have to come from far off places as much as 4 to
5 km to reach nearest school.
5. The quality of education is very poor and pass percentage is low compare
to towns.
6. School dropout rate is very high. Often boys drop from class VIII and girls
from class IV.
7. Guidance to parents does not exist.
8. Development funds do not reach and are siphoned by corrupt officials atvarious levels.

High Cost by Private schools
There is mushrooming of private schools everywhere in small towns and in
metro towns. There are big brand name schools like Delhi Public School and
small school which work like shop (unorganized sector). Most of schools run
under a society name which is supposed to be on no loss and no profit basis. In
the name of society these schools extract lot of benefits, aides from government
and spin money.
The quality of education in unorganized proprietor based schools is very poor.
The teachers are low paid. The fees are quite high depending upon locality and
availability of educated class in the area. Thus fees can be from Rs. 25 to 500
per month per child.
The branded schools in metro towns are blood suckers of parents. They chargeheavy fees, heavy transport fees, development fees and so on from time to
time.The monthly fees in branded public schools range from Rs 5000/-
to Rs 50000/-.
Besides they also charge huge capitation fees at time of entry. The parents of
rich or medium class have to struggle in their life to pay high cost of schooling
in their life.
The regulatory for private schools always favors school management and lets
them charge heavy fees and fee hikes from time to time.
